This page is no longer maintained (). For the most current information, go to https://docs.snaplogic.com/public-apis/post-project-git-tag-project-path.html.

POST /project/git-tag/{project_path}

Overview

This API associates the specified Git tag with the commit that is currently tracked by the specified project.

Prerequisites

Learn more: SnapLogic - Git Integration

Request

POST https://{pod_path}/api/1/rest/public/project/git-tag/{project_path}

Path Parameters

Key

Description

pod_path

Required. The path to your SnapLogic pod.

Example: elastic.snaplogic.com

project_path

Required. The path to the SnapLogic Project.

Format: {org}/{project_space}/{project_name}

The path comparison is case-sensitive.

Query Parameters

None.

Request Header

Specify Basic for authorization and application/json for content type.

Authorization: Basic {your_encoded_security_credentials}

Content-Type: application/json

Request Body

{
  "tag" : "...",
  "message" : "..."
}

Key

Type

Description

tag

string

The Git tag to associate with the latest files in the Git repository.

message

string

Additional information about the added tag.

Response

Response Body

 {
  "response_map": {
    "tag_sha": "...",
    "tag": "...",
    "message": "...",
    "tagger": "myemail@example.com",
    "commit_sha": "..."
  },
  "http_status_code": 200
}